CIVIL SERVICE COMMISSION MEETING
Meeting Minutes of April 14, 2009
The regularly scheduled meeting of the Civil Service Commission was held April 14, 2009, in Resource
Room #2 located on the second floor of Auburn City Hall, 25 West Main Street, Auburn, WA. The
following members were in attendance.
MEMBERS PRESENT: Dick Kammeyer, Chairman; Chuck Booth, Member; Cyril Van Selus, Member.
STAFF PRESENT: Terry Mendoza, Civil Service Examiner Pro Tem; Jim Kelly, Police Chief; and
Steven Gross, Assistant City Attorney.
ACTION:
Chairman Kammeyer called the meeting to order at 3:30 p.m.
Approval of the March 10, 2009, Civil Service Commission meeting minutes:
• Minutes were accepted as written. Motion by Van Selus, Booth seconded.
Chairman Kammeyer advised the commission that the Civil Service Secretary/Chief Examiner position is
officially vacant and recommended appointing the current Civil Service Examiner Pro Tem.
0 Motion by Booth to appoint Terry Mendoza as Secretary/Chief Examiner, Van Selus seconded.
Terry Mendoza presented the following:
• Civil Service entry level Police Eligibility list; adopted as published. Motion by Booth, Van Selus
seconded.
• Civil Service entry level Correctional Officer Eligibility list; adopted as published. Motion by
Booth, Van Selus seconded.
• Information regarding revising the current entry level Police Officer written examination process.
POLICE DEPARTMENT:
The following updates were provided:
• The number of candidates in the background process and the number of conditional offers out for
entry level police, lateral level police and police services specialist.
- ADJOURNMENT:
There being no further business to come before the Commission, the meeting adjourned at 3:35 p.m.
